Overview
VP Role: Requirements Generation for Regulated Flows. Identity & Authentication Domain Knowledge. Demonstrated ability to manage and align multiple technical dependencies across engineering, architecture, and business teams.
Responsibilities
AVP Role: Requirements Generation for Event-Driven Flows – Strong understanding of messaging patterns and event-driven architecture concepts. End-to-End Requirements Ownership Across Distributed Systems – Proven ability to manage complex dependencies and ensure alignment across multiple platforms and stakeholders.
Desirable Skills
- Multi-Channel Notification Strategy – experience defining requirements for customer communications across mobile, web, email, SMS, and other channels.
- Proven experience translating complex regulatory and compliance requirements into clear, testable specifications within Payments or Financial Services Regulation.
- Strong understanding of Public Key Infrastructure (PKI) and certificate-based authentication mechanisms.
- Experience leveraging AI tools to enhance requirement analysis, traceability, and test case generation.
- Experience working within large-scale, regulated financial services environments with strong governance frameworks.
